Dr. Robert Morris, Cameron Stovall to deliver Helen Keller Lecture at Troy University

Dr. Robert Morris examines the eyes of Cameron Stovall, who lost his sight in a hunting accident. The two will speak at TROY's Helen Keller Lecture.

Dr. Robert Morris examines the eyes of Cameron Stovall, who lost his sight in a hunting accident. The two will speak at TROY's Helen Keller Lecture.

Renowned eye surgeon Dr. Robert Morris and cornea transplant recipient Cameron Stovall will deliver Troy University’s annual Helen Keller Lecture at 10 a.m. on April 25.

The event, which is free and open to the public, will be held in the Trojan Center Theatre on the Troy Campus.

TROY First Lady teaches etiquette to future leaders

A group of 45 students and five Chancellor's Fellows took part in an etiquette class hosted by TROY First Lady Janice Hawkins.

A group of 45 students and five Chancellor's Fellows took part in an etiquette class hosted by TROY First Lady Janice Hawkins.

Troy University First Lady Janice Hawkins believes in the importance of good manners.

For years, she has conducted etiquette classes for leadership students and Chancellor’s Fellows, and Monday saw a new group learn from her example.
